软判决和硬判决

来源:互联网 发布:用c语言编写科学计算器 编辑:程序博客网 时间:2024/05/17 01:18

软判决就是解调器将解调后的模拟信号直接接入到译码器来实现解码。

硬判决就是对解调器输出信号做N比特量化,分量高于门限就认为输出为1,否则输出为0(根据调制方式,如MPSK,M=2^N,则N比特量化)

在数字通信系统,可以认为硬判决就是N比特量化,软判决就是多比特量化(>>N)

在均匀量化,信号在其空间均匀分布得到的情况下,多一个比特可以多得到6dB的增益。

在数字通信的差错控制中,对于纠错码,通常利用码字的代数结构知识,进行硬判决译码。对常用的二进制来说,就是解调器输出供给硬判决译码器用的码元仅限于两个值0和1。若接收电压的幅度(或抽样电压的幅度)小于0,则解调器输出为1,若大于或者等于0,则输出为1。解调器的这种硬判决结果,损失了波形信号中所包含的有关信道干扰的统计特性信息,译码器不能充分利用解调器匹滤波器的输出,从而影响了译码器的错误概率。为了充分利用接收信号波形中的信息,使译码器能以更大的正确概率来判决码字,需要把解调器输出的抽样电压进行量化。这时供给译码器的值就不止两个,而有Q个(通常Q=2^m),然后译码器利用Q进制序列译码,称为软判决译码。

 

 


0 0
原创粉丝点击